Burger King, By Royal Decree

Hongkongers have largely been deprived of the chance to sample McDonald’s biggest worldwide rival, except in the rarefied atmospheres of the airport and The Peak. However with expansion underway, BK is coming soon to a corner near you. We of course went for The Whopper ($27), a quarter-pound patty on a sesame bun, which came topped with lettuce, tomato, onion, dill pickles, cream mayo and ketchup.

What our tasters said: “I’m not convinced this patty has been flame-grilled... It does have a decent barbecue-y flavour though, and it is huge... Good crisp lettuce and nicely sweet tomato – much better than I’d expect from a fast-food chain... The toppings deserve to be on a better patty... Just the right amount of sauce... The bun’s a little dry, but it keeps the toppings together better than most.”

Meat: 6/10
Bun: 6/10
Toppings: 6/10
Value: 8/10
Overall: 6/10 Satisfying and filling, it’s an effective – if unspectacular – way to divert those hunger pangs. And yes, it’s better than McD’s.

Five locations. We got ours from: Airport, Level 7, Departures East Hall.
